Understanding Appointed Representatives




Appointed representatives play a important function in the framework and functioning of businesses, acting as a trustworthy link of contact between the company and the government. https://rosario-neville.thoughtlanes.net/the-reason-why-every-enterprise-needs-a-authorized-agent-top-reasons registered agent is an individual or a company entity designated to handle legal documents, such as tax notifications and service of process, on behalf of the business. This need is vital for guaranteeing that businesses are informed of any lawful actions or regulatory issues in a timely manner.




The responsibilities of a appointed agent go further than merely receiving legal documents. They also assist uphold the business's compliance with government regulations by ensuring that required filings and paperwork are completed and submitted without delay. Furthermore, designated representatives aid protect a company's confidentiality by giving an legal address where legal documents can be delivered, rather than using the owner's private location. This feature is especially helpful for individual business owners and small businesses aiming to maintain their privacy.

When evaluating registered agent services, grasping the costs involved is essential for businesses. Typically, registered agent fees can fluctuate from a modest amount to higher prices depending on the provider and the specific services included. Most companies offer fundamental services starting at $50 to three hundred dollars per year. It is important to evaluate what you receive for your money, as some registered agent companies include extra features such as compliance alerts and document scanning in their packages.




Comparing registered agent companies can reveal notable differences in pricing structures. Cheaper registered agent services may seem attractive, but it's crucial to consider reliability and the level of customer support provided. Businesses should look for trustworthy registered agent providers with strong reviews to avoid possible issues. A well-rounded analysis will include not just the price but also the value of the services provided, such as business mail handling and compliance management.

Compliance and Legal Responsibilities




A registered agent holds a vital role in making sure that a business meets regulatory and compliance obligations. Their primary responsibility is to accept and administer legal documents on behalf of the company, such as legal notices and state compliance correspondence. By acting as the designated receiver for these legal documents, a registered agent assists maintain the secrecy of business owners, minimizing the likelihood of having sensitive information made public.




In addition, registered agents are charged for staying up to date with state regulations and requirements related to business operations. This involves ensuring timely submission of annual reports, keeping proper business registration, and alerting the company of any changes in state compliance laws. Engaging a reliable registered agent service can alleviate the burden of managing these responsibilities, allowing business owners to focus on their essential activities.




Finally, failing to meet compliance requirements can lead to major penalties, including fines, revocation of business license, and even individual liability for business owners. Therefore, choosing the right registered agent company is crucial in protecting not only the business's compliance but also its reputation. By ensuring that all legal documents are handled quickly and appropriately, registered agents play a key role in corporate governance and compliance management.
